EXPRESS: Rethinking Hospitality Leadership: Cultivating Human-Robot Co-working Harmony through Rapport Leadership

Xi Yu Leung, Dan Jin, Xiaolin (Crystal) Shi

The integration of collaborative robots (cobots) into the hospitality workforce signals the need for a fresh leadership approach to facilitate smooth collaboration between humans and robots. Drawing from a thorough literature review and the synthesis of leadership theories, this conceptual study proposes a framework for a novel leadership style – rapport leadership – tailored to foster harmony among human and robot colleagues in the hospitality sector. Rapport leadership comprises four key elements: technological agility, emotional assurance, dynamic authority, and flexible adaptability. Compared to existing leadership models, rapport leadership represents a paradigm shift, introducing new mindsets, sources of inspiration, empowerment strategies, and ethical standards for future hospitality leaders. The findings offer practical insights for hospitality leaders seeking to embrace this new leadership approach to navigate and excel in a collaborative human-robot co-working environment.
